Mark Teixeira Injury: Yankees 1B Could Be Out Awhile

After re-aggravating his leg while trying to sprint out the final out of the New York Yankees' 5-4 loss to the Baltimore Orioles on Saturday night, Mark Teixeira is feeling sore, but his recovery from the initial injury has not been completely undone, according to Yankees manager Joe Girardi.

Girardi told the Associated Press on Sunday that Teixeira was scheduled for an MRI and was likely to miss time, including Sunday’s final game in a four-game series between the Yankees and Orioles.

“I don’t think he’ll be a player for us,” Girardi told the AP. “I’d be surprised, but we’ll just have to wait and see. He’s sore — he doesn’t feel like it’s back to square one, but it’s sore.”

Teixeira returned Saturday after a 10-day absence because of the injury to his calf. Teixeira went 1-for-4 on Saturday night in his return.
